Cryptocurrency Options: From Niche Strategies to Core Market Structure

Options, once the domain of quant teams and hedge funds, are now becoming the preferred tool for native crypto investors. These contracts give traders the right (not the obligation) to buy or sell assets at a set price—enabling complex hedging, volatility trading, and directional speculation.

As the digital asset market matures, cryptocurrency options are increasingly seen as a key part of the financial infrastructure. Reports this month indicated that Coinbase is in rumored talks to acquire the market-leading BTC and ETH options platform Deribit for a reported $40-50 billion, bringing this narrative into the mainstream spotlight. While the negotiations have cooled off, the message from the market is clear: crypto derivatives are no longer supporting characters; they have become the main act.

Youngest in the Top Five—Fastest Growth

Coincall's breakout is notable not only for its speed but also for its relative youth. The exchange, founded in late 2023, has now risen to the ranks of top exchanges, currently making up 9-10% of Deribit's size.

According to Laevitas data, during the period from March 8 to 17, 2025, Coincall's average market share reached 5.43%, with a peak of 10.15% on March 15. The exchange recorded market shares of 9.78% on March 8 and 6.64% on March 16, demonstrating its momentum and competitiveness in the global crypto options space.

Coincall's relative market share and growth trajectory have made it the youngest exchange to ever break into the top five and potentially one of the most likely candidates among emerging platforms for acquisition or institutional partnerships. As attention shifts from established giants to agile challengers, Coincall has become the centerpiece of this discussion, with its market share nearing industry leader ByBit.
